To give detailed basic ınformation about history of endodontics, anatomy of teeth, endodontic access cavities, endodontic ınstruments, chemical and mechanical root canal preparation, ultrastructure, histology, embryology, physiology, biochemistry, and pathology of pulp are given.

| 1. | To understand the endodontic access cavities, endodontic instruments, chemical and mechanical root canal preparation of the pulp. |
| 2. | To have information about ultrastructure, histology, embryology, physiology, biochemistry, and pathology of pulp. |
| 3. | To have informationabout the endodontic access cavities, endodontic instruments, chemical and mechanical root canal preparation of the pulp. |
| 4. | To realise the endodontic instruments and importance of irrigation solution. |
| 5. | To learn principles of endodontics access cavity preparation and endodontic treatment steps and endodontic materials. |
| 1. | Çalışkan K. Endodontide Tanı Ve Tedaviler Nobel Tıp Kitap Evi 2008 |
| 2. | Hargreaves KM, Goodis HE, Seltzer And Bender’s Dental Pulp, Quintessence Books, 2002 |
| 3. | Walton RE, Trobinejad M, Principles And Practise Of Endodontics,WB Saunders, 2001 |
